Transaction 2e3ac831461ec280f6eb91f79864a6fec40031ae10fb2ff67d2cf41f03fb4539
1 Input
1 Output
-
2e3ac831461ec280f6eb91f79864a6fec40031ae10fb2ff67d2cf41f03fb4539:0
- value
- 5125869
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8618c5559f216b87488e18ed3fd076212bd33263 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DE3DpAnnpSGF7fosKEhCMG3AdypoH38rU